Today launches a new series on the Gospel of Matthew, challenging the modern claim that Mark was the first gospel written. In this episode, host Steve Wood explores how the Mark-priority and “Q source” theories arose, why they contradict 1,700 years of Church teaching, and how they weaken the apostolic authority of Matthew—especially Matthew 16.
